    With the changing energy landscape, natural gas is facing competition from renewables as a clean energy source but will still be the mainstay for several years to come. To remain a sustainable source of energy, gas development and production is faced with several challenges – from handling contaminants and GHG emissions, to developing frontier and marginal fields. With the growing demand for gas, depleting resources and challenging gas plays such as tight gas, unconventional, marginal, stranded/frontier and high contaminant fields need to be developed. In addition to cost-effective technology and innovative concepts, suitable regulation with attractive terms and conditions is critical to monetising such gas fields to meet the ever-growing energy demand.

    This session will delve into mature, marginal, and stranded gas fields around Southeast Asia and India. These are the showcase of innovation through technology and collaborative efforts to breathe new life into mature, marginal, and stranded gas fields.

    From unlocking shallow biogenic gas potential in Indonesia and achieving an 80% increase in intermittently producing gas wells through cost effective measures, this session will hold a comprehensive discussion to identify potential risks and uncertainties to maximise and economically exploit gas reserves and revitalise gas production. This is an opportunity to delve into collaborative efforts among diverse stakeholders into reviving a gas infill project and revolutionising gas field development with automation and technology. This session will feature a rich tapestry of insights into the potentials and overcoming challenges in mature, marginal, and stranded gas fields.
